This is a podcast that explores and unpacks the stories of passionate creatives who inspire us. We'll feature artists, photographers, filmmakers, musicians, writers, and just all-around cool people. Everyone's got a cool journey that we could learn from, and it's our goal to provide a platform for them to share their experiences.
